Cyprus Museum
Ayios Andreas, Cyprus · built 1882
The Cyprus Museum (Kypriakó Mouseío, Kıbrıs Müzesi), also known as the Cyprus Archaeological Museum (Archaiologikó Mouseío tis Kýprou, Kıbrıs Arkeoloji Müzesi), is the oldest and largest archaeological museum in Cyprus, located on Museum Street in central Nicosia. The museum is home to the most extensive collection of Cypriot antiquities in the world, and houses artifacts discovered during numerous excavations on the island. Its history goes hand in hand with the course of modern archaeology (and the Department of Antiquities) in Cyprus. Of note is that only artefacts discovered on the island are displayed.
